Abstract

A ballistic test barrel system includes a fixture, a chamber in the fixture, a barrel extending from the chamber, and an observation window in or on the chamber.

Claims (38)

1 . A ballistic test barrel system comprising:

a fixture;

a chamber in the fixture;

a barrel extending from the chamber; and

an observation window in or on the chamber,

wherein the observation window comprises crystalline aluminum oxide.

2 . The system of claim 1 wherein the observation window is transmissive to visible light.

3 . The system of claim 1 wherein the observation window is transmissive to infrared radiation.

4 . The system of claim 1 wherein the fixture comprises a base and a clamp connected to the base.

5 . The system of claim 4 wherein the clamp comprises a viewing port that is aligned with the observation window.

6 . The system of claim 1 wherein the barrel is releasably connected to the chamber.

7 . The system of claim 6 wherein the barrel is configured to threadingly engage the chamber.

8 . The system of claim 6 comprising a plurality of barrels each configured to be selectively connected to the chamber, wherein different ones of the plurality of barrels comprise different barrel lengths and/or different bore diameters.

9 . The system of claim 1 further comprising a cartridge configured to be received in the chamber, wherein the cartridge comprises a transparent housing.

10 . The system of claim 1 further comprising a plurality of cartridges, wherein each of the plurality of cartridges comprises a housing having substantially identical exterior dimensions, and wherein the housings of different ones of the plurality of cartridges have different interior volumes for varying powder load and/or different inner diameters for varying projectile caliber.

11 . The system of claim 1 further comprising a camera above the fixture and configured to capture optical and/or infrared images and/or video.

12 . A method for observation of interior ballistics phenomena, the method comprising:

providing a ballistic test barrel system comprising:

a fixture;

a chamber in the fixture;

a barrel extending from the chamber; and

an observation window in or on the chamber, wherein the observation window comprises crystalline aluminum oxide;

inserting a cartridge comprising a transparent housing into the chamber;

firing the ballistic test barrel system including igniting propellant in the cartridge; and

capturing an image or video of the propellant and/or a projectile held in the cartridge through the observation window.

13 . A ballistic test barrel system comprising:

a fixture comprising a base and a clamp connected to the base;

a chamber in the fixture;

a barrel that is releasably connectable to the chamber; and

an observation window in or on the chamber,

wherein the clamp comprises a viewing port that is aligned with the observation window.

14 . The system of claim 13 wherein the barrel is configured to threadingly engage the chamber.

15 . The system of claim 14 wherein the barrel comprises a plurality of barrels each configured to threadingly engage the chamber, wherein different ones of the plurality of barrels have different barrel lengths and/or different bore diameters.

16 . The system of claim 15 further comprising a plurality of cartridges, each cartridge having substantially the same exterior dimensions and configured to be received in the chamber, wherein different ones of the plurality of cartridges have different interior powder volumes and/or different inner diameters at a mouth of the cartridge.

17 . The system of claim 16 wherein the plurality of cartridges comprise at least one cartridge having a first inner diameter and at least one cartridge having a second inner diameter, and wherein the plurality of barrels comprise at least one barrel having a first bore diameter corresponding to the first inner diameter and at least one barrel having a second bore diameter corresponding to the second inner diameter.

18 . The system of claim 13 wherein the observation window comprises crystalline aluminum oxide.

19 . The system of claim 13 wherein the observation window is transmissive to visible light.

20 . The system of claim 13 wherein the observation window is transmissive to infrared radiation.
